Новости

Linux на ChromeOS — это постоянно развивающийся проект. На этой странице вы найдете последние обновления и объявления.

Введение багета

Мы рады объявить о новом поколении архитектуры для Linux на ChromeOS, которое мы называем Baguette. Baguette отличается от классического Crostini тем, что исключает использование контейнеров — среда разработки Linux теперь будет работать непосредственно в виртуализированной гостевой системе.

Переход на новую архитектуру позволит нам предложить ряд улучшений, в том числе:

  • Более быстрая установка и запуск.
  • Удаление устаревших зависимостей от lxc, что позволит, например, поддерживать cgroups v2.
  • Более прямой доступ к виртуализированной гостевой системе из Crostini, позволяющий, например, монтировать файлы подкачки на хосте.
  • Возможность запускать собственные контейнеры, например, Docker, Podman и т. д.

Начиная с версии M147, Baguette будет устанавливаться по умолчанию в ChromeOS, но его можно будет контролировать с помощью флага #containerless-crostini в chrome://flags.

В настоящий момент мы предлагаем только установку нового оборудования Baguette, но следите за обновлениями, чтобы узнать, как обновить уже установленное оборудование.

Прекращение поддержки новых функций

К сожалению, мы приняли решение отказаться от некоторых функций в Linux на ChromeOS. К ним относятся:

  • Обновление Debian через пользовательский интерфейс.
  • Установка/удаление приложений Linux (.deb-файлов) с помощью пользовательского интерфейса.
  • Поддержка нескольких контейнеров.
  • Поддержка настройки контейнеров на основе Ansible.

Кроме того, существует ряд функций, которые, хотя и не устарели, больше не поддерживаются . Это означает, что, хотя они могут по-прежнему работать, их не будут исправлять в случае поломки, в том числе:

  • Поддержка IME.
  • Графическое ускорение.